About the Property

Picturesque Garden Setting: Firefly Cottage is a charming escape nestled in a lush garden, offering a serene atmosphere for relaxation.

Luxurious Amenities: Enjoy access to a tennis court, squash court, and a patio for outdoor gatherings. The fully equipped kitchen and private entrance ensure a comfortable stay with added privacy.

Exciting Activities: Embark on adventures like snorkeling, fishing, and hiking in the beautiful surroundings of Kenton on Sea, creating unforgettable moments during your stay.

The king-sized bed was comfortable with very clean bedding/linen. There were lots of pillows. The hosts were very approachable and friendly and had made an information booklet, and gave us restaurant suggestions. It is within walking distance to Middle Beach and other places. The hosts included a small microwave, air fryer, kettle, 2 coffee pods and a pod machine, a kettle, instant coffee and tea bags, a 5 litre bottle of filtered rain water (which is what they drink), a bit of dish soap, TP, and even a couple of beach towels! - enough to get one started. The suite was nicely spacious for 2, and had a very small deck, table and 2 chairs for an outside breakfast. The couple even offered to let us use their outside space, although we would not have wanted to impose. Laundry facilities were also made available to us. The couple had also stocked the suite with a few games and books, and had a functional TV with Netflix, etc. Kenton-on-Sea is a lovely, friendly, seemingly safe village with all the benefits of 2 rivers, beaches, the sea, beautiful views, incredible birdlife and viewing and even more natural wonders.

The village water system is potable, but reportedly doesn't taste good, which we didn't find out until we arrived. -but our hosts supplied us with 5 litres of filtered rain water to start, which was lovely. The suite is not completely an independent structure. The hosts' laundry area backs onto the bedroom window, as the suite appears to have been developed from a former third garage - but it is still spacious for 2 people. The deck is small and closely fenced, so you can hear birds on the property, but you cannot usually see them . On our last morning there, however, a beautiful wood hoopoe spent a lot of time searching the fencing for food - which provided for some great photos and much entertainment. The flooring is cement, but this makes it easier to rid oneself of the bit of sand that seems to make it in no matter what you do. The parking area is at a slant, which may prove challenging for people with significant mobility issues. There is a slight musty odour in the suite, but I expect that this is unavoidable in such a warm, humid climate. No air-conditioner, just FYI.
